Dans cet article, nous aurons expliqué les étapes nécessaires pour installer et configurer Webmin sur Ubuntu 18.04 LTS. Avant de poursuivre ce didacticiel, assurez-vous que vous êtes connecté en tant qu'utilisateur avec des privilèges sudo. Toutes les commandes de ce didacticiel doivent être exécutées en tant qu'utilisateur non root.
Webmin est une interface Web d'administration système pour Unix. À l'aide de n'importe quel navigateur Web moderne, vous pouvez configurer des comptes d'utilisateurs, Apache, DNS, le partage de fichiers et bien plus encore. Webmin supprime le besoin de modifier manuellement les fichiers de configuration Unix comme /etc/passwd, et vous permet de gérer un système depuis la console ou à distance.
Installer Webmin sur Ubuntu
Étape 1. Tout d'abord, avant de commencer à installer un package sur votre serveur Ubuntu, nous vous recommandons de toujours vous assurer que tous les packages système sont mis à jour.
sudo apt update sudo apt upgrade sudo apt install software-properties-common apt-transport-https
Étape 2. Installez Webmin sur Ubuntu 18.04 LTS.
Importez la clé Webmin GPG à l'aide de la commande wget suivante :
wget -q http://www.webmin.com/jcameron-key.asc -O- | sudo apt-key add -
Ensuite, activez le référentiel Webmin :
sudo add-apt-repository "deb [arch=amd64] http://download.webmin.com/download/repository sarge contrib"
Ensuite, installez la dernière version de Webmin en tapant :
sudo apt install webmin
Une fois installé, le serveur Webmin démarrera automatiquement comme on peut le voir en exécutant la commande systemctl ci-dessous :
systemctl status webmin
Étape 3. Ajustez le pare-feu.
Par défaut, Webmin écoute les connexions sur le port 10000 sur toutes les interfaces réseau. Si votre serveur exécute un pare-feu UFW, vous devrez ouvrir le port Webmin :
sudo ufw allow 10000/tcp
Étape 4. Accédez à Webmin.
Le serveur Webmin écoute sur le port 10000. Vous pouvez désormais accéder au panneau de contrôle Web via :
https://your-server-ip:10000
Parce qu'il fonctionne en mode https et utilise un certificat TLS auto-signé, le navigateur vous dira donc que la connexion n'est pas sécurisée.
C'est tout ce que vous avez à faire pour installer le panneau de configuration open source Webmin sur Ubuntu 18.04. J'espère que vous trouverez cette astuce rapide utile. Si vous avez des questions ou des suggestions, n'hésitez pas à laisser un commentaire ci-dessous.